What period of the maternity cycle does the intrapartal period cover?

  • A. Beginning of pregnancy to midterm
  • B. Conception to third trimester
  • C. Onset of labor to delivery of the baby
  • D. Onset of labor to delivery of the placenta
Correct Answer: D

Rationale: The intrapartal period of the maternity cycle covers the onset of labor to delivery of the placenta. The antepartal period begins at conception and continues until the onset of labor. The postpartal period begins after the delivery of the placenta and continues for approximately 6 weeks, until the reproductive organs return to their prepregnancy state.
